Understanding the Outlook Email Data Limit
Let’s start by understanding what the Outlook email data limit actually means. The data limit refers to the maximum amount of data that you can store in your Outlook email account. This includes emails, attachments, contacts, calendar entries, and more. Once you reach this limit, you may experience issues such as not being able to send or receive emails, missing important notifications, or even losing access to your account.
So, what exactly is the data limit for Outlook emails? The specific limit can vary depending on the type of account you have – whether it’s a free Outlook.com account, a Microsoft 365 subscription, or a work or school account. Usually, the data limit ranges from 15 GB to 100 GB, but it’s important to check the terms and conditions of your specific account to know the exact limit.
